Logistics Provider Transition — Managers Only

This page documents the planned move from Carthew Freight to Norrell Logistics, effective next fiscal year. Finance should note the revised cost structure: per-pallet rates drop 6%, but fuel surcharges are now passed through quarterly. Contract termination fees with Carthew are accrued through Q2. Invoice coding changes take effect at cutover. The broader commercial context driving this decision is recorded below.

internal memo for hahaf-kahof: Only 39 of the 428 pilot accounts renewed Sorion, so a churn review is set for April 12. Praokix Freight is in early talks to buy Queniusox Group for about $145.8 million.

Quarterly Planning Note — Divestiture of the Coastal Tooling Unit

For the finance team: the sale of the Coastal Tooling unit to Pellmark Industries remains on track for close in Q3. Please finalize the carve-out balance sheet, reconcile intercompany positions, and prepare the working-capital adjustment schedule by month-end. Audit support requests should be prioritized. For planning purposes, note the following sensitive item:

internal memo for hawef-kahif: The finance team signed off on a budget of $25.9 million for Project Sorox. The renewal with Pelokek Logistics closes at $51.7 million a year, 52 percent below the last contract.

Quarterly Planning Note — Divestment of Kelbourne Unit

Team, quick update: the sale of the Kelbourne packaging unit is moving faster than expected. Diligence wraps next month, and Orvath Partners remains the lead bidder. Finance should start modelling the post-sale balance sheet now rather than waiting. Keep workings out of shared drives. The confidential summary of next steps sits just below.

board note of hahaf-fahog: The pricing group signed off on a budget of $229.3 million for Project Aldius.

## Limits and Quotas: Encoding Detection

When users upload text files to Scriptorium, the detection pass sniffs a bounded prefix of the file to guess the encoding before the full parse. Sniffing the whole file was murdering upload latency for big CSVs, so we cap the sample size, the number of candidate encodings we score, and the confidence threshold for falling back to UTF-8. These caps matter for release sign-off since they change rejection behavior at the edges. The current limits are defined as follows.

limits module of yadug-bahip:
QUOTAS = {
    "oliath": 10,
    "holath": 5,
}